Hi all. I don't generally promote things on fora, but I think the prospect of getting a new cartridge to dump on our retrodes is worthy of some acknowledgment.  ;D

I'm not affiliated with the project, but I'm guessing that somebody around here is going to be interested.

http://www.kickstarter.com/projects/698159145/atari-2600-star-castle (http://www.kickstarter.com/projects/698159145/atari-2600-star-castle)

But anyways, for $50 you can get a limited edition cart with the game on it and some nice goodies. For a lower sum you just get it in an emulator friendly format. It'll be going until May 24th and has already hit the level necessary to ensure that it's funded.
